Current Landscape of Acetic Acid Integration in Canada

Analyzing the intersection of chemical purity and food safety standards in the Canadian market.

The Canadian food manufacturing sector, particularly in provinces like Ontario and Quebec, relies heavily on glacial acetic acid for its versatile role as a preservative and acidity regulator. Given Canada's rigorous health regulations, the demand for ultra-pure grades that minimize metallic impurities is paramount to ensure food-grade compliance.

Logistically, the extreme temperature fluctuations in North America require specialized handling of glacial acetic to prevent premature crystallization during winter transport. This has led to a market preference for suppliers who provide optimized thermal packaging and precise purity certificates.

Furthermore, the rise of organic and clean-label food trends in Canada has shifted the focus toward highly controlled acoh glacial applications, where minimal residue and high reactivity are essential for synthesizing high-quality food additives without altering the final taste profile.

How do I ensure the purity of glacial acetic acid for food-grade applications in Canada?

Ensure your supplier provides a Certificate of Analysis (CoA) that specifies the absence of heavy metals and confirms a purity level of 99.8% or higher, meeting Health Canada's food additive standards.

What are the safety protocols for diluting glacial acetic acid in industrial settings?

Always add acid to water, never water to acid, to avoid violent exothermic reactions. Use specialized PPE and ensure the dilution area is equipped with industrial-grade ventilation.

How is anhydrous acetic acid stored during Canadian winters?

Due to its freezing point, it must be stored in climate-controlled warehouses or using heat-traced piping to prevent crystallization and maintain flowability.
